Today's efforts rarely show immediate results. Often, we need to wait weeks, months, or years to see the benefits from our recent efforts. This is why we need to develop the skill of delayed gratification.

Every action we take involves decision-making. But sometimes, decisions don't turn out as we expect.

It's odd, but even correct decisions can lead to negative outcomes. However, in the long term, the right decision always reveals itself.

We should trust that the right decision, will eventually pay off, even if it takes longer than expected.

This is why it's important to learn how to make better decisions, based on logic and values. Emotional decisions often lead us towards short-term rewards at the expense of a better future.
